Matsushima Kaijō Hanabi Taikai transforms Japan's iconic bay — dotted with over 260 pine-covered islands — into a natural theater for fireworks. Shells are launched from the water, so reflections shimmer across the bay and the silhouettes of the famous islands add dramatic framing. Sightseeing boats offer premium offshore viewing, while the promenade and Godaido shore platform provide excellent free vantage points. The juxtaposition of cultural heritage scenery and contemporary pyrotechnics makes this one of the most visually distinctive hanabi events in the Tohoku region.
